What is an Emergency Car Key Locksmith?

An emergency situation car key locksmith is a specific service company who assists motorists in opening their automobiles and developing brand-new car type in immediate scenarios. Unlike routine locksmith professionals who mainly deal with property and industrial locks, car key locksmiths are trained to handle the complex lock systems found in modern cars. They can open car doors, produce new keys, and even program key fobs, all while guaranteeing the security and security of your vehicle.

Providers Offered by Emergency Car Key Locksmiths

Emergency situation car key locksmith professionals provide a vast array of services to assist you in times of requirement. A few of the most typical services consist of:

  • Car Unlocking: If you lock your keys inside the car, a locksmith can unlock the doors without causing damage.
  • Key Cutting: They can produce a new key for your vehicle, whether you've lost your original or need an extra copy.
  • Key Programming: Modern cars and trucks frequently utilize transponder keys, which require to be programmed to the vehicle's computer system. A locksmith can do this for you.
  • Ignition Repair: If your key is damaged or the ignition is malfunctioning, a locksmith can repair or replace the essential parts.
  • Lock Cylinder Replacement: In cases where the lock cylinder is damaged or broken, a locksmith can replace it and supply you with a brand-new key.
  • Keyless Entry System Repair: For vehicles with keyless entry systems, a locksmith can diagnose and repair issues with the sensing units and receivers.

FAQs About Emergency Car Key Locksmiths

  1. What should I do if I lock my keys in the car?

    • Stay calm and examine the situation. If the car is in a safe location, call an emergency situation car key locksmith. They will show up rapidly to unlock your vehicle without triggering damage.
  2. Can a locksmith make a new key if I've lost the original?

    • Yes, an expert locksmith can produce a brand-new key using your vehicle's VIN number or by utilizing a code from the vehicle's producer.
  3. Are emergency situation car key locksmiths more costly than routine locksmith professionals?

    • Generally, emergency situation car key locksmith professionals may charge more due to the specialized nature of their services and the urgency of the scenario. Nevertheless, they are typically more cost-effective than hauling your vehicle to a car dealership.
  4. The length of time does it take for a locksmith to get here?

    • Many reputable emergency situation car key locksmith professionals intend to arrive within 30 minutes to an hour, depending on your place and their existing workload.
  5. Can a locksmith aid with keyless entry system issues?

    • Yes, many locksmiths are trained to diagnose and repair keyless entry systems, including concerns with sensing units and receivers.
  6. What should I look for in a locksmith's credentials?

    • Ensure the locksmith is certified by the relevant state or local authorities. Furthermore, check if they are bonded and insured to secure you from any liabilities.
